F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E Nexus, one of the hotel industry’s leading providers of online sales management systems, announced today the completion of a direct interface between its own worXcentral database and Reconline’s Central Reservations System (CRS). Reconline offers CRS and Distribution services to over 6,000 hotels and the new connection will mean a huge reduction in manual input for all properties subscribing to Nexus’ services. The primary purpose of the interface is to make it easy for Reconline hotels – mainly independent properties and small chains – to apply for inclusion in various hotel programs processed through the Nexus RFP system. The RFP process requires hotels to submit hundreds of fields of data to clients, many of which also reside in the Reconline CRS database, though often in a different format. With the new interface as much as 95% of data needed for RFP participation is transferred between the two systems, saving hotels considerable time and money. Geoff Andrew, Nexus’ Managing Director comments, “Reconline has a very large base of hotels and this latest development makes life considerably easier for those involved in the RFP process. In fact, we expect the improved efficiency to result in double the number of hotels responding to bids this rate season compared to last – and that means more business for everyone.” Markus Maissen, Reconline’s founder and CTO adds: “We are a highly automated organization and welcome any opportunity to eliminate double entry and make processes quicker and easier for hotels. Nexus has a very important role to play in helping us deliver business to our properties so it makes sense to maximize the number of hotels applying for next year’s programs.” |
